Insomnia Cookies already has several shops in Virginia, including Richmond, Blacksburg, and Charlottesville, but this will be its first in Fairfax County. Delivery options will also be available at the new store. Popular cookie flavors include chocolate chunk, snickerdoodle, and s’mores deluxe. The company did not immediately indicate when it plans to open, but its website anticipates that it will open “soon.”įounded by a University of Pennsylvania student in 2003, Insomnia Cookies sells fresh cookies and ice cream. The plaza is anchored by Giant and includes other businesses like Domino’s, United Bank and Gathering Grounds Cafe. ![]() The business plans to open up shop soon in University Mall at 10669 Braddock Road, according to its website. Good news for George Mason University students and anyone else looking for a late-night snack: Insomnia Cookies is adding a location in Fairfax County.
